#257960 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#257960 is composed of 14.5% red, 47.5%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 20.7% yellow and 52.5% black. It has a hue angle of 162.1 degrees, a saturation of 53.2% and a lightness of 31%. #257960 color hex could be obtained by blending #4af2c0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#257960

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#f1fbf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#257960

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#495551 is the less saturated color, while #019d6f is the most saturated one.
